Mine gets a little better than 22 MPG driving around town when driving easy. I get around 30 MPG on the highway using cruise control and doing 65 MPH. BUT, it has a LOT to do with how heavy your foot is on the gas pedal. If you have a heavy foot and drive the car hard, it goes down dramatically. Drive it easy and it's surprisingly good. When I first got mine (used), it only got about 18 MPG around town. It intermittently ran slightly rough on startup but showed no problems when diagnostics were done. Knowing that all other parts were good, I took a chance and replaced the coil pack. Replacing the coil pack fixed the roughness and improved the mileage considerably.
